Why Choose Vinyl Siding?
1. Durability and Weather Resistance
Cleveland experiences a variety of weather conditions, from heavy snowfall in winter to high humidity in summer. Vinyl siding is designed to withstand these elements, making it an excellent choice for homeowners in the region. It resists moisture, preventing issues such as rot and mold growth that are common with traditional wood siding. Additionally, modern vinyl siding is engineered to withstand high winds, making it a reliable option for Cleveland’s unpredictable weather.
2. Low Maintenance
Unlike wood or brick, vinyl siding requires minimal maintenance. A simple wash with a garden hose and mild detergent is enough to keep it looking new. This eliminates the need for frequent painting, staining, or repairs, saving homeowners both time and money in the long run.
3. Cost-Effectiveness
Vinyl siding is one of the most budget-friendly exterior options available. The material is less expensive than wood or fiber cement, and because it requires little maintenance, it saves homeowners on long-term upkeep costs. Additionally, professional installation is often more affordable compared to other materials.
4. Energy Efficiency
Many vinyl siding options come with insulation, helping to regulate indoor temperatures and improve energy efficiency. This can reduce heating and cooling costs, which is particularly beneficial in Cleveland, where winters can be harsh and summers humid. Insulated vinyl siding acts as an extra barrier against temperature fluctuations, keeping homes comfortable year-round.
5. Variety of Styles and Colors
Vinyl siding is available in an extensive range of colors, textures, and styles, allowing homeowners to customize their exteriors to match their aesthetic preferences. Whether you prefer a classic wood grain appearance or a modern sleek finish, there is a vinyl siding option to suit your taste.
Choosing the Right Vinyl Siding for Your Home
1. Thickness and Quality
When selecting vinyl siding, it is essential to consider thickness and quality. Higher-grade vinyl siding is thicker and more durable, offering better resistance to impact and weather elements. Thin, lower-quality siding may be cheaper but can be prone to cracking and fading over time.
2. Insulated vs. Non-Insulated Siding
Homeowners in Cleveland should consider insulated vinyl siding for added energy efficiency. Insulated siding has a foam backing that improves insulation, reduces noise, and enhances the overall durability of the material. While it may cost more upfront, the long-term savings on energy bills make it a worthwhile investment.
3. Color and Style Selection
Choosing the right color and style is crucial for enhancing curb appeal. Light-colored siding can make a home appear larger and reflect sunlight, keeping interiors cooler in the summer. Darker colors provide a bold and sophisticated look but may absorb more heat. Additionally, siding styles such as clapboard, Dutch lap, and board-and-batten offer different aesthetic effects.
4. Warranty and Longevity
Look for vinyl siding that comes with a strong manufacturer’s warranty. Many reputable brands offer warranties of 25 years or more, providing peace of mind that your investment is protected.
Installation and Maintenance
1. Professional Installation
Proper installation is key to maximizing the benefits of vinyl siding. Hiring a professional siding contractor in Cleveland ensures that the siding is installed correctly, reducing the risk of warping, buckling, or moisture infiltration. A skilled contractor will also ensure that the siding is properly sealed and ventilated.
2. DIY Installation Considerations
While some homeowners may consider installing vinyl siding themselves, it requires skill and precision. Incorrect installation can lead to gaps, improper sealing, and other issues that may compromise the siding’s durability and effectiveness. If opting for a DIY approach, it is essential to follow manufacturer guidelines and use the right tools.
3. Routine Maintenance Tips
Although vinyl siding is low-maintenance, occasional cleaning is necessary to prevent dirt buildup and maintain its appearance. Use a soft brush or cloth along with a mild detergent to clean the siding. Avoid using harsh chemicals or abrasive cleaning tools, as these may damage the finish.
Finding a Reliable Vinyl Siding Contractor in Cleveland, Ohio
1. Check Credentials and Reviews
Before hiring a siding contractor, research their credentials, experience, and customer reviews. Look for contractors with a strong reputation and positive feedback from previous clients.
2. Request Estimates
Obtain quotes from multiple contractors to compare pricing and services. Be wary of estimates that are significantly lower than others, as they may indicate low-quality materials or subpar workmanship.
3. Verify Licensing and Insurance
Ensure that the contractor is licensed and insured. This protects you from liability in case of accidents or damage during the installation process.
4. Ask About Warranty and Service Guarantees
A reputable contractor should provide a warranty on both materials and labor. Clarify the terms of the warranty and any service guarantees before committing to a contractor.
